2. Safety Information
- Power Supply: Use a DC9-24V/3A or above power supply. Do not connect to a 24V battery pack directly. Ensure the power supply voltage is stable and within the specified range.
- Speaker Compatibility: Connect speakers with an impedance of 4-8Ω and a power rating of 15-100W. Using incompatible speakers may damage the amplifier board.
- Protection Mechanisms: The board includes built-in overheating, overcurrent, short circuit, and voltage protection. However, avoid operating the device under extreme conditions to prevent triggering these protections unnecessarily.
- Environment: Operate the amplifier in a dry, well-ventilated area. Avoid exposure to moisture, dust, or extreme temperatures.
- Handling: Handle the board with care to avoid damaging electronic components. Avoid touching the circuit board while powered on.

4. Product Overview
The ZK-502MT is a compact 50W x 2 Bluetooth-Compatible audio amplifier module designed for home passive speakers. It features Bluetooth 5.0 connectivity and an AUX input, along with independent treble and bass controls for sound customization.

5. Specifications
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Product Model | ZK-502MT |
| Bluetooth Version | 5.0 (unobstructed range up to 15 meters / 49 feet) |
| Signal to Noise Ratio (SNR) | > 90dB |
| Input Method | AUX + Bluetooth-Compatible |
| Number of Channels | Left and right dual channels (Stereo) |
| Adaptive Power Supply | DC9~24V / 3A or above (cannot be connected to 24V battery pack) |
| Compatible Speaker Impedance | 4~8Ω |
| Compatible Speaker Power | 15~100 W |
| Output Power (at 8Ω) | 12V: 12W+12W, 15V: 18W+18W, 19V: 30W+30W, 24V: 40W+40W |
| Output Power (at 4Ω) | 12V: 20W+20W, 15V: 30W+30W, 19V: 40W+40W, 24V: 50W+50W |
| Protection Mechanisms | Overheating, Overcurrent, Short Circuit, Voltage Protection |
| Product Dimensions (L*W*H) | 89mm * 60mm * 21mm (overall, including connectors/knobs) |
| Board Dimensions (L*W) | 74mm * 60mm (board only) |
| Product Weight | Approximately 111g (including packaging) |

6. Setup Instructions
- Install Heat Sink: Attach the provided heat sink to the amplifier chip on the board. Ensure good contact for efficient heat dissipation.
- Connect Speakers: Connect your passive speakers to the speaker output terminals (L+, L-, R+, R-) on the amplifier board. Ensure correct polarity. Use the small screwdriver for secure connections.
- Connect Power Supply: Connect a DC9-24V power supply (3A or higher) to the DC power input jack. If using the included DC power adapter connector, wire it to your power supply.
- Install Knobs: Place the three control knobs onto their respective shafts (Volume, Treble, Bass).
- Power On: Once all connections are secure, turn on the power supply. The amplifier board will power on.
7. Operating Instructions
7.1. Bluetooth Connection
- Ensure the amplifier board is powered on.
- On your audio source device (e.g., smartphone, tablet), enable Bluetooth and search for available devices.
- Select "ZK-502MT" from the list of devices to pair. A confirmation sound may indicate successful pairing.
- Once paired, audio from your device will play through the connected speakers.
7.2. AUX Input Connection
- Connect your audio source device to the AUX-IN port on the amplifier board using a 3.5mm audio cable.
- The amplifier will automatically switch to AUX input when a cable is detected.
7.3. Adjusting Audio
- Volume Control: Rotate the Volume knob to adjust the overall output level.
- Treble Control: Rotate the Treble knob to increase or decrease high-frequency sounds.
- Bass Control: Rotate the Bass knob to increase or decrease low-frequency sounds.
